OK, another year, another winter. Another attempt to protect my 18' ceramic plant filled with mini hosts and two other 12" planters, with Wheeee! and heuchie Georgia Peach in them. Last year's experiment was placing a Rubbermaid Brute green garbage can over the stacked pots with a prominent label "Winter Plant Shelter", which was stolen.

This year, I went with 2 large spring green plastic bowls I had poked a hot screwdriver through on the sides, both to ruin them for other uses by potential thieves and to give me a place to hook my bungee cords into. The 18" pot was covered with---now don't laugh, but I know you will---a saucer type plastic sled disk. It fit over the 18" pot with about 3" extending beyond the pot. I put some of the holes I poked into the 2 green bowls a bit too high---do you think a lot of precip can enter the pots through 4 holes approximately 1/8" in diameter? Is a 3" overhang of the plastic sled enough to keep the 18" sufficiently dry?
